>> Wondering if there is a way to remove multiple system profiles from  
>> RHN
>> in one shot?
>> These are machines that are no longer in use, or have taken licenses
>> that don't belong to them...
>
> Add them all the the System Set Manager (ie: click the checkbox next  
> to them
> in the "Systems" tab) then hit "Manage" in the top-right.
> There should be an option at the bottom of the screen to "Delete  
> Selected
> Systems".
>
> *** Make sure you start with an empty SSM set! ***
